Output 0ab9698ecdaf2802199723ccacdc613e1ef5df024b03488ceb909b739a877f37:0

value
20957225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d051602c2142e458c35a8ff4e94ac6e97ab4f5e OP_EQUAL
address
3AArrmGUxHT8W643GRUhXiTXV7ySsbro7e
transaction
0ab9698ecdaf2802199723ccacdc613e1ef5df024b03488ceb909b739a877f37
confirmations
334110
spent
true